To achieve both of support rigidity and assembling accuracy of a bumper face in a normal time and collision stroke in a vehicle front section in head-on collision even in a vehicle having high vehicle height.SOLUTION: A front structure of a vehicle includes: vehicle body members (15, 17) which are provided in a vehicle body front section; a bumper face support member 18 which supports a bumper face 3 in front of the vehicle body members (15, 17); and a plurality of brackets 20 which connect and fix the vehicle body members (15, 17) and the bumper face support member 18. Each of the brackets 20 has an inclined section 26 which is inclined to the outside in a vehicle width direction toward the front, high rigidity sections (63U, 63D) which have at least a part positioned in the inclined section 26 and are configured to have high rigidity with respect to input load in a longitudinal direction, and fragile sections (62, 61f, 61r) which are configured to be deformable with respect to the input load in the longitudinal direction. The high rigidity sections (63U, 63D) and the fragile sections (62, 61f, 61r) are provided to be adjacent to each other in the longitudinal direction.SELECTED DRAWING: Figure 2
